The cocktail was brought to life in 1888 by Henry Charles Carl Ramos at the Imperial Cabinet Saloon in New Orleansa combination of gin, citrus, a sweetener, heavy cream, egg white, and orange blossom water, topped with club soda to give it its iconic souffl-like head. However, some place the origin of the true French 75, which combines gin (or cognac if at Arnauds French 75 in New Orleans), Champagne, lemon juice and sugar, at Harrys New York Bar in Paris, in 1915,explained McKibben.
